Home
last modified time | relevance | path

Searched refs:isl_swizzle (Results 1 – 20 of 20) sorted by relevance

/third_party/mesa3d/src/intel/isl/
Disl.h1554 struct isl_swizzle { struct
1561 #define ISL_SWIZZLE(R, G, B, A) ((struct isl_swizzle) { \ argument
1619 struct isl_swizzle swizzle;
1717 struct isl_swizzle swizzle;
2030 struct isl_swizzle swizzle,
2035 struct isl_swizzle swizzle);
2352 isl_swizzle_is_identity(struct isl_swizzle swizzle) in isl_swizzle_is_identity()
2362 struct isl_swizzle swizzle) in isl_swizzle_is_identity_for_format()
2378 struct isl_swizzle swizzle);
2380 struct isl_swizzle
[all …]
Disl.c3219 struct isl_swizzle swizzle) in isl_swizzle_supports_rendering()
3271 swizzle_select(enum isl_channel_select chan, struct isl_swizzle swizzle) in swizzle_select()
3294 struct isl_swizzle
3295 isl_swizzle_compose(struct isl_swizzle first, struct isl_swizzle second) in isl_swizzle_compose()
3297 return (struct isl_swizzle) { in isl_swizzle_compose()
3308 struct isl_swizzle
3309 isl_swizzle_invert(struct isl_swizzle swizzle) in isl_swizzle_invert()
3332 return (struct isl_swizzle) { chans[0], chans[1], chans[2], chans[3] }; in isl_swizzle_invert()
3354 struct isl_swizzle swizzle, in isl_color_value_swizzle()
3370 struct isl_swizzle swizzle) in isl_color_value_swizzle_inv()
/third_party/mesa3d/src/intel/blorp/
Dblorp.h158 enum isl_format src_format, struct isl_swizzle src_swizzle,
161 enum isl_format dst_format, struct isl_swizzle dst_swizzle,
188 enum isl_format format, struct isl_swizzle swizzle,
219 enum isl_format format, struct isl_swizzle swizzle,
Dblorp_priv.h300 struct isl_swizzle src_swizzle;
326 struct isl_swizzle dst_swizzle;
Dblorp_clear.c450 enum isl_format format, struct isl_swizzle swizzle, in blorp_fast_clear()
513 enum isl_format format, struct isl_swizzle swizzle, in blorp_clear()
547 const struct isl_swizzle ARGB = ISL_SWIZZLE(ALPHA, RED, GREEN, BLUE); in blorp_clear()
Dblorp_blit.c982 struct isl_swizzle swizzle, nir_alu_type data_type) in swizzle_color()
2518 enum isl_format src_format, struct isl_swizzle src_swizzle, in blorp_blit()
2521 enum isl_format dst_format, struct isl_swizzle dst_swizzle, in blorp_blit()
/third_party/mesa3d/src/gallium/drivers/crocus/
Dcrocus_resource.h52 static inline struct isl_swizzle
55 struct isl_swizzle swz; in pipe_to_isl_swizzles()
Dcrocus_blit.c607 struct isl_swizzle src_swiz = pipe_to_isl_swizzles(src_fmt.swizzles); in crocus_blit()
608 struct isl_swizzle dst_swiz = pipe_to_isl_swizzles(dst_fmt.swizzles); in crocus_blit()
Dcrocus_clear.c332 struct isl_swizzle swizzle, in clear_color()
Dcrocus_state.c2731 .swizzle = (struct isl_swizzle) { in crocus_create_sampler_view()
2767 isv->gather_view.swizzle = (struct isl_swizzle) { in crocus_create_sampler_view()
3084 struct isl_swizzle swiz = pipe_to_isl_swizzles(fmt.swizzles); in crocus_set_shader_images()
/third_party/mesa3d/src/gallium/drivers/iris/
Diris_formats.c43 struct isl_swizzle swizzle = ISL_SWIZZLE_IDENTITY; in iris_format_for_usage()
Diris_resource.h41 struct isl_swizzle swizzle;
Diris_clear.c312 struct isl_swizzle swizzle, in clear_color()
Diris_state.c2341 struct isl_swizzle swizzle, in fill_buffer_surface_state()
2574 .swizzle = (struct isl_swizzle) { in iris_create_sampler_view()
/third_party/mesa3d/src/intel/vulkan/
Danv_private.h3326 struct isl_swizzle swizzle;
3335 struct isl_swizzle ycbcr_swizzle;
3432 static inline struct isl_swizzle
3433 anv_swizzle_for_render(struct isl_swizzle swizzle) in anv_swizzle_for_render()
3832 enum isl_format format, struct isl_swizzle swizzle,
3874 enum isl_format format, struct isl_swizzle swizzle,
3882 enum isl_format format, struct isl_swizzle swizzle,
4028 struct isl_swizzle swizzle,
Danv_nir_lower_ycbcr_textures.c184 swizzle_channel(struct isl_swizzle swizzle, unsigned channel) in swizzle_channel()
Danv_blorp.c1555 enum isl_format format, struct isl_swizzle swizzle, in anv_image_clear_color()
1808 enum isl_format format, struct isl_swizzle swizzle, in anv_image_mcs_op()
1898 enum isl_format format, struct isl_swizzle swizzle, in anv_image_ccs_op()
Danv_image.c2450 struct isl_swizzle format_swizzle) in remap_swizzle()
DgenX_cmd_buffer.c972 struct isl_swizzle swizzle, in anv_cmd_predicated_ccs_resolve()
1005 struct isl_swizzle swizzle, in anv_cmd_predicated_mcs_resolve()
Danv_device.c4587 struct isl_swizzle swizzle, in anv_fill_buffer_surface_state()